On Sun, Jun 19, 2011 at 4:19 AM, Uwe Grawert <graw...@b1-systems.de> wrote: > Hello, > > on RHEL6.1 I tried to configure stonith using the fencing plugins from the > fence-agents packet. I used the fence_bladecenter agent and it failed. It > turned out, that Pacemaker adds parameters: option, nodename, port. "port" > is already a mandatory parameter that has to be configured in the CIB for > this agent and it is a number. Pacemaker adds this parameter again with the > name of the node to fence.
